Sonoma Sheriff arrests 2 in mail, package thefts involving at least 90 victims

Authorities in Sonoma County arrested two people last week suspected of committing mail and package thefts involving dozens of victims.

On Monday, the Sonoma County Sheriff’s Office announced results of the investigation, which was prompted by an increase in mail thefts in the Sonoma Valley over recent months.

Within the past two weeks, deputies said they were able to identify two primary suspects. Deputies in a statement thanked community members who provided video surveillance footage during the investigation…
